On 3 October 2011, the band released an EP titled Clash, featuring two new songs and four remixes of them. The band released their second official single, "Suzy", on 24 February 2009. The album performed best in the band's native France where it attained a peak position of 11 in August 2009, and remained on the French albums chart for 68 consecutive weeks. In Switzerland, the album reached number 72 and in Belgium it achieved a position of 42. The album received praise for its traditional jazz inclinations, and placed in a number of European albums charts. On 20 October 2008 the self-titled Caravan Palace was released, preceded by the single "Jolie Coquine".

They spent the next year recording material for their debut studio album. Following this emergence, the group were signed by the Paris-based Wagram Music record label. From 2006 to 2007 they spent a year touring around France, and their first festival appearance came at the Django Reinhardt Jazz Festival in 2007. The band became popular on the internet after releasing a number of demos and promo singles. More performers were required for the live concerts and the other three current band members were found after searching on MySpace.

Once the bell tents are suitably decorated it’s off to the (perfectly manicured and positively gleaming) faux-wilds of Wilderness to firstly, hit up the hilariously high end booze tents (there’s a Talisker "Wild Spirit" bar, a Sipsmith "Gin Palace" and a Veuve Clicquot champagne garden) secondly, get kitted up in the tightest, sparkliest sequins you can squeeze yourself into and then thirdly try your hand at one of the titillating pastimes on offer. You can choose from axe throwing, wild swimming, nature runs, horse riding, wild medicine walks, outdoor life drawing there’s yoga for days (hotpod, aerial, paddleboard, colour flow, teen, beats, yin, rise and shine) or sit yourself down for a five minute philosophy puppet show, long table banquet or fancy dress cricket match. Such frivolity comes before anyone even mentions there might be music playing somewhere around here. I had so many conversations with people that began, “I’ve no idea who any of these bands are…” and while I (secretly) enjoyed mocking their musical bewilderment (in jolly good faith, you understand) it is of course fine that people are here for the lifestyle indulgence elements as much as the tunes – which is why the line up is made up of talks, classical and jazz music, contemporary dance, poetry, debates, crafting, mindfulness practices and art – all washed down with a re-fuel at Petersham Nurseries or a late-night pit stop at Patty and Bun. Gig-wise, you can come for the music or you can avoid the mainstream – on a few occasions we tripped past the main stage, wound up in the Jump Yard, and ended up staying there – the first time for Thrill Collins, an acoustic three-piece of self-proclaimed “no good street punks” from Milton Keynes re-arranging covers of well known pop songs with some serious skill and infectious energy.
